When Zeus scientists engineered a process to increase lubricity while decreasing drag force through micro-structured channels, or \u201creeds,\u201d we immediately thought the applications could be exponential in many industries. We have seen success as customers from industries such as automotive, aerospace, fiber optics, semiconductors, and oil and gas have eagerly explored uses for this exciting technology.<\/p>\n<p>The \u201creeds\u201d created by our manufacturing process on the outside of this tubing lower the coefficient of friction by reducing surface contact area. Without additives or fillers, our engineered surface process enhances the lubricity on either the inner or outer (or both) surfaces. Zeus can apply engineered surface on a range of high-performance extruded products, including PTFE, PEEK, FEP, PFA, PVDF, ETFE, and Nylon.<\/p>\n<p>Wire, cable, and fiber optics industries routinely assemble bundles, often with tacky but necessary sheathing, making them difficult to maneuver. These bundles also frequently need to be pushed down long sections of tubing to shield them from temperature extremes, moisture, and aggressive chemicals. Our engineered surface tubing provides an excellent vehicle to accomplish this and many similar tasks, saving production and lead times, which translates into cost savings.<\/p>\n<p>Independent testing found that Zeus PEEK engineered surface tubing was up to 42 percent more lubricious than standard PEEK tubing<sup>1<\/sup>. Zeus engineers didn\u2019t sacrifice the performance characteristics of PEEK to achieve this improved lubricity.<\/p>\n<p><sup>1<\/sup><strong>Disclaimer:<\/strong>\u00a0The repeatability of tests on the same material will depend upon material homogeneity, machine, and material interaction. It is important to note that friction is a system property; therefore, comparing this data to the data obtained from other sources should be done with caution.
